  • Tomaszow Lubelski: Located approximately 11km from Susiec, Tomaszow Lubelski is a charming city that offers a delightful mix of culture, adventure, and scenic beauty. The city's history museum provides insights into the region's past, while the nearby national parks invite visitors to explore lush landscapes and unique wildlife. Peak travel occurs from July to September, making it an ideal time for tourists seeking vibrant cultural events and outdoor activities. With its welcoming atmosphere, Tomaszow Lubelski is a perfect stop for those looking to immerse themselves in local traditions and natural beauty.
  • Narol: Also situated around 11km from Susiec, Narol is a city steeped in history and culture. This destination is particularly known for its memorial and Holocaust museum, which serve as poignant reminders of the past. Travel to Narol peaks from June to August, attracting visitors interested in cultural experiences and historical education. The city's moderate seasonal appeal ensures a quieter visit during the off-peak months, offering a more personal exploration of its significant landmarks and serene surroundings.
  • Krasnobrod: Located about 14km from Susiec, Krasnobrod is a city that captivates visitors with its rich cultural heritage and stunning natural parks. The seasonal influx of tourists from June to August highlights the city's popularity during the summer months, making it a vibrant hub for outdoor enthusiasts and history buffs alike. The Holocaust museum and various memorials provide meaningful insights into the region's history, while the natural parks offer breathtaking scenery for hikers and nature lovers. Krasnobrod is a must-visit for those seeking both cultural enrichment and outdoor adventure.

Best time to go to Susiec

The best time to visit Susiec is dependent on what kind of holiday you are seeking. July is its hottest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are high and weather is mostly sunny with light rain. January is its coolest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are average and weather is very cloudy with no rain.

calendar iconCalendar Monthtemperature iconTemperaturerain iconPrecipitationmostly cloudy iconCloudinessoccupation rate iconOccupancyprice iconPricing
January27.9°F (-2.3°C)No RainVery CloudyAverageSlightly Low
February30.0°F (-1.1°C)No R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
March37.4°F (3.0°C)No R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ly High
April48.0°F (8.9°C)No R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
May56.8°F (13.8°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ly Low
June64.6°F (18.1°C)Light RainMostly SunnyHighAverage
July67.6°F (19.8°C)Light RainMostly SunnyHighSlightly High
August67.5°F (19.7°C)Light RainMostly SunnyHighAverage
September58.3°F (14.6°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
October48.2°F (9.0°C)Light RainMostly SunnyLowSlightly Low
November40.1°F (4.5°C)No RainMostly CloudyLowAverage
December31.6°F (-0.2°C)Light RainMostly CloudyLowSlightly High

The nearest major airports for your trip to Susiec

Flying into Susiec, Lublin Voivodeship can be accomplished via two major airports. Rzeszow Airport (RZE-Jasionka) is approximately 90km away, with convenient hotels nearby such as the 5-star Bristol Tradition and Luxury and the 4-star Grand Hotel Boutique, both located about 8km from the airport. Transportation services include on-request airport shuttles. Lublin Airport (LUZ) is around 98km from Susiec, with excellent options like the 5-star Hotel ALTER, situated 10km away. Hotels near Lublin also offer airport shuttle services, making access straightforward for travellers. Both airports provide a good range of flight options for your journey.
